Anyone
looking for a romantic hideaway perfect for carrying
on a forbidden affair should look no further than
the aptly named Noir (the only fixtures that aren't
black are the red lamps). High-backed black banquettes
are ideal for canoodling, as is the hipster soundtrack.
Vixenish, black-clad cocktail waitresses pass out
pocket flashlights to those who have trouble reading
the menu
Libation lovers should feel right at home here,
as the drink menu is full of stylish signature
martinis--think caramel-apple and strawberry-basil
concoctions--and "Film Noir Drinks" ("Noir's
Boudoir" combines vanilla vodka, Godiva liqueur,
Kahlua, cream, and chocolate-covered espresso
beans for a sinful pleasure). The bar menu, designed
by Rialto's Jody Adams, consists of upscale noshes
like crudites with ginger-water chestnut dip
and a duck, Gruyere and cranberry chutney sandwich
Those looking for a savory drink should try the
Blue Cheese martini, which is shaken tableside
and comes with pungent, hand-stuffed Cachael
olives
